Comprehending Remote Car Keys
Remote car keys, typically understood as key fobs, been available in different forms. The most frequently acknowledged types consist of:
Basic Remote Keys: These normally enable users to unlock the car door and sometimes use features like panic alarms.Transponder Keys: These keys consist of a chip that interacts with the car's ignition system. It's crucial for starting the vehicle, adding an extra layer of security.Smart Keys: These sophisticated devices enable keyless entry and ignition. The Remote Car Key Replacement Process
The procedure for replacing a remote car key can vary based upon the kind of key and the vehicle's maker. However, generally, it follows these key steps:

Identifying the Key Type: Determine the particular type of key your vehicle utilizes (standard remote, transponder, or clever key).

Finding the Right Replacement:
Visit Dealership: Contacting the car dealership is often the most simple approach, although this can be more costly.Auto Locksmith: A licensed auto locksmith professional can offer a more affordable option and typically has the devices needed to program the key.Online Retailers: Many online platforms offer replacement keys, though buying from unproven sources might cause compatibility problems.
Setting the Key: Many modern remote keys need programming, which normally can be done by professionals. Checking the Key: Once replaced and configured, it's vital to evaluate all functions of the brand-new key, consisting of unlocking doors and beginning the engine.
